Spring jUnit 测试 - 无法自动装配或找不到 appContext.xml
我正在对基于 spring 的应用程序 atm 进行单元测试。 首先的问题是,如果我没有在服务器上启动应用程序一次,单元测试都会失败。 如果我首先在服务器…
尝试使用 Spring 运行 jUnit 测试时出现 NoSuchFieldError
到目前为止我有两个测试。一种仅使用 jUnit 框架并且工作正常。另一个使用 spring-test 库,并在每次我尝试运行它时创建此异常。有什么想法可能会导致…
有没有办法在测试环境中运行 junit / TestNG 测试用例?
我是 spring 框架的新手。我在 Rails 框架方面有一些经验。 我计划创建 3 个环境(测试、开发、生产), 我已在我的 pom 文件中为每个环境创建了配置…
项目布局和弹簧测试支持问题
我们的项目布局如下。 src src/test/java src/test/resources 并且我们无法添加 src/main/(java, resources) 代码,因为早期开发尚未完成。 src/test/…
Spring MVC 测试加载 xml fie 时出错
我的代码可以工作,但在以下行的 Junit 模拟测试中失败。 ApplicationContext ctx = new ClassPathXmlApplicationContext("../MyFile.xml"); 我该如何…
正确使用子类化 spring ContextLoader 进行测试
对于我的 spring 应用程序与 junit 的集成测试,我对 org.springframework.test.context.ContextLoader 进行子类化,因为我想使用已经存在的 XmlWebAp…
使用 maven-surefire 运行测试时,Spring-Autowiring 在 @BeforeClass 之后发生
我在依赖注入(Spring 自动装配)和 maven-surefire 方面遇到一些问题。 当使用 TestNG 在 eclipse 中运行时,以下测试可以正常工作: 注入服务对象,…
使用 Junit 的 Spring 测试会话范围 bean
我有一个会话范围的 bean,它保存每个 http 会话的用户数据。我想编写一个 Junit 测试用例来测试会话作用域 bean。我想编写测试用例,以便它可以证明…
Spring Test 中事务未回滚删除操作
不知何故,我的测试在进行 Spring 测试时没有回滚删除事务。数据将被永久删除。 我正在使用 Spring-Hibernate 组合。 这是我的测试类: @RunWith(Spri…
如何编写多个测试的 Spring 测试套件并运行选择性测试?
我在一个测试类中有很多 spring 测试方法。我只想进行选择性测试。所以我想在同一类中创建一个测试套件。 @RunWith(SpringJUnit4ClassRunner.class) @…
如何使 @BeforeClass 在 Spring TestContext 加载之前运行?
对于使用 testNG 的程序员来说这应该是小菜一碟。我有这种情况 @ContextConfiguration(locations={"customer-form-portlet.xml", "classpath:META-INF…
JUnit 测试在 Eclipse 中通过,但在 Maven Surefire 中失败
我使用 JUnit 4 和 spring-test 库编写了一些 JUnit 测试。当我在 Eclipse 中运行测试时,运行良好并通过。但是当我使用 Maven 运行它们时(在构建过…
如何使用 Spring Test 为每个案例加载一次 DBUnit 测试数据
Spring Test 有助于回滚测试方法中对数据库所做的任何更改。这意味着无需在每次测试方法之前花时间删除/重新加载测试数据。 但如果您使用 @BeforeClas…
在春季测试中请求范围内的bean
我想在我的应用程序中使用请求范围的 bean。我使用 JUnit4 进行测试。如果我尝试在这样的测试中创建一个: @RunWith(SpringJUnit4ClassRunner.class) …